Output 46fdc632f4688f4b28c354999f5e94ae93c64e0120643fae8fa344ddc1308dce:1

value
168480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d07b58c8c7191b95d9424308286c0a12e2f39e4 OP_EQUAL
address
3MqiVafRm3AH5kNNCnN8vatrbo91WcbKXo
transaction
46fdc632f4688f4b28c354999f5e94ae93c64e0120643fae8fa344ddc1308dce